如何在数据分析中使用常用性能指标?
在当今这个大数据时代,数据分析已经成为各行各业的重要工具。为了更好地评估数据的价值和效果,了解并运用常用的性能指标显得尤为重要。本文将深入探讨如何在数据分析中使用常用性能指标,帮助您在数据驱动决策的道路上更加得心应手。
一、了解常用性能指标
在数据分析中,常用的性能指标包括以下几种:
准确率(Accuracy):准确率是指模型预测正确的样本数量占总样本数量的比例。准确率越高,模型越稳定。
召回率(Recall):召回率是指模型预测正确的正样本数量占总正样本数量的比例。召回率越高,模型对正样本的识别能力越强。
F1值(F1 Score):F1值是准确率和召回率的调和平均数,用于平衡准确率和召回率。F1值越高,模型性能越好。
AUC(Area Under the ROC Curve):AUC是指ROC曲线下的面积,用于评估模型区分正负样本的能力。AUC值越高,模型性能越好。
RMSE(Root Mean Square Error):RMSE是均方误差的平方根,用于衡量回归模型的预测误差。RMSE值越小,模型预测的准确性越高。
MAE(Mean Absolute Error):MAE是平均绝对误差,用于衡量回归模型的预测误差。MAE值越小,模型预测的准确性越高。
二、如何使用常用性能指标
确定指标类型:根据数据分析的目的和需求,选择合适的性能指标。例如,在分类问题中,准确率、召回率和F1值较为常用;在回归问题中,RMSE和MAE较为常用。
计算指标值:根据数据集和模型,计算各个性能指标的值。
比较模型性能:将不同模型的性能指标进行比较,选择性能最佳的模型。
调整模型参数:根据性能指标的结果,调整模型参数,优化模型性能。
监控模型性能:在实际应用中,定期监控模型性能,确保模型稳定可靠。
三、案例分析
假设某公司希望通过数据分析预测客户流失情况,采用以下步骤进行:
数据收集:收集客户的基本信息、消费记录、服务满意度等数据。
数据预处理:对数据进行清洗、去重、填充等处理。
特征工程:根据业务需求,提取有价值的特征。
模型选择:选择适合的模型,如逻辑回归、决策树等。
模型训练与评估:使用训练集对模型进行训练,并使用测试集评估模型性能。
结果分析:根据性能指标,如准确率、召回率和F1值,选择性能最佳的模型。
模型部署:将模型部署到实际业务中,预测客户流失情况。
通过以上步骤,公司可以有效地预测客户流失,并采取相应措施降低客户流失率。
总之,在数据分析中使用常用性能指标,有助于我们更好地评估模型性能,优化模型参数,提高数据分析的准确性。在实际应用中,我们需要根据具体问题选择合适的性能指标,并灵活运用各种方法,以实现数据驱动决策的目标。
猜你喜欢:网络流量采集